DescriptionThis papyrus, written in Greek, contains a letter from Isidorus to his son, Demetrius, asking for a colt and some medicines to treat it.
Published ReferencesHunt, Arthur S., The Oxyrhynchus Papyri, London, 1912, vol. IX, pp. 265-266, no. 1222.
